CloseIn Philippians 1, Paul seems to be sitting alone, quietly, reminiscing about his time at his favourite church. It reflects the tenderness between a church and one of its missionaries. The apostle is thankful for the church and the encouragement it has been to him over the years, and he offers prayers to God for it as a means to encourage it.
